ABSTRACT

Although population-based cancer registries have reported lower incidence of WaldenstrÓ§m macroglobulinemia (WM) in East Asia than in Western countries, previous retrospective analyses have found the clinical features of WM to be similar in these two populations. To clarify the characteristics of Japanese WM patients, we retrospectively analyzed clinical and laboratory characteristics, treatments, outcomes, and prognostic factors in 93 patients with WM. Based on the Second International Workshop on WM (IWWM-2) criteria, symptomatic WM was found in 73 (78.5%) and asymptomatic WM in 20 (21.5%) of cases examined. The median overall survival (OS) was similar to that in reports from Western countries. Patients receiving treatment regimens including rituximab exhibited significantly better survival than those not given rituximab. Although prognostic factors for WM in Western countries may not apply to Japanese patients, our finding that newly diagnosed WM patients with pleural effusion have a poorer prognosis suggests that this may be a novel predictor of adverse prognosis in symptomatic WM.

ABSTRACT

We retrospectively surveyed patients who received a second transplantation for graft failure (GF) after allogeneic hematopoietic stem cell transplantation (SCT) in hospitals participating in the Kanto Study Group for Cell Therapy. A second SCT was performed in 21 of 45 patients with primary GF and in 13 of 15 with secondary GF. The median time between the first and second SCT was 49 days (range, 18-1204 days). The diagnosis included 28 patients with hematologic malignancies and 6 with aplastic anemia. Non-myeloablative or reduced-intensity conditioning was performed in 30 patients. Cord blood was frequently used as the source of stem cells followed by related donor peripheral blood, and unrelated bone marrow. Engraftment was achieved in 23 patients (68%). Conditioning regimen including total body or total lymphoid irradiation, was significantly associated with a higher engraftment rate. Overall survival at 5 years in all patients who underwent second SCT was 34%. Prognostic factors for better survival after second SCT were a time to second SCT longer than 90 days, the performance status at second SCT with 0 or 1, and the administration of tacrolimus for GVHD prophylaxis. The major cause of death after second SCT was infection. Although the outcome of a second SCT for graft failure remains poor, these findings suggest that the selection of patients as well as transplant methods, such as conditioning and GVHD prophylaxis, may contribute to survival.

ABSTRACT

We evaluated the clinical outcome of 92 patients younger than 60 years who were treated between January 1987 and May 2003. Low, Int-1, Int-2 and High risk groups categorized by IPSS consisted of 7, 34, 24 and 27 patients, respectively. There was no significant difference in the overall survival between 30 patients who received allogeneic stem cell transplantation and 62 patients who did not. Allogeneic stem cell transplantation provided significantly better outcomes in the Int-2 and the High risk groups. Risk factors for overall survival were age and disease status at transplantation. Acute and chronic GVHD did not influence the relapse free survival rate. Allogeneic stem cell transplantation is a curative therapy for MDS. It is necessary to reduce transplantation related death and to perform stem cell transplantation as soon as possible for patients with Int-2 or High risk of IPSS.
